Book Review: Space Travel at it's Best
Summary: 5 Stars

"A Wrinkle in Time" tells the story of Meg and Charles Wallace who go into outer space to find their missing father. Along with their friend,Calvin, they meet three mysterious women with powers who help them in their search. With their new alien friends, the children enter a tesseract, a wrinkle in time, and discover a world terrorized by the evil It.
The children discover that by depending on each other and solving problems, one at a time, every goal can be reached.
This book has lots of action and it's characters are children whose reactions are very realistic, given their situations. If you like science fiction and love to read about the possibilities of time travel, you will love it.

Book Review: An Exciting Fictional Story
Summary: 5 Stars

When Meg and Charles Wallace are visited by an old lady, she tells them about a tesseract. She invites them to her house and when they go they meet her two friends. They do a thing called tessering and travel to a different planet. The kids find out that they have to save their father and the Earth. They go to a planet called Camozotz and have to fight the power of IT, a brain that controls life on Camozotz. I did like this book because of all the things that are going on, but be careful because some parts are hard to understand. Read the book to find out what happens. Hope you like it!!!
